THIS PAPER CONSIDERS A NOVEL FORMULATION OF MULTI-PERIOD NETWORK INTERDICTION PROBLEM. IN THIS FORMULATION, THE SEND OF MAXIMUM FLOW AND THE ACT OF INTREDICTION CAN BE HAPPEN IN DURING OF SEVERAL PERIOD OF TIME, WHERE THE BUDGET OF RESOURCE FOR INTERDICTION AND THE ARC CAPACITY IS COMMON IN DURING OF THESE SEVERAL PERIOD OF TIME. WE TRANSFORM THE RESULTING BI-LEVEL MIN-MAX MODEL TO THE SINGLE MINIMUM LINEAR PROBLEM BY TAKING DUAL FROM INNER MAXIMIZATION PROBLEM AND STANDARD LINEARIZTION TECHNIQUES.

UNCERTAINTY IS AN INTRINSIC CHARACTERISTIC OF A DECISION MAKING PROCESS. SOMETIMES THERE ARE NO SAMPLES, AND HISTORICAL DATA ARE NOT ENOUGH TO ESTIMATE AN APPROPRIATE PROBABILITY DISTRIBUTION FOR AN UNCERTAIN VARIABLE. IN THESE SITUATIONS, UNCERTAINTY THEORY INITIATED BY LIU IN 2007 COULD BE A POTENTIALLY POWERFUL AXIOMATIC FRAMEWORK TO MANAGE THIS SORT OF UNCERTAINTY WHICH IS THE BASE OF THIS STUDY. THIS PAPER CONSIDERS THE UNCERTAIN NETWORK INTERDICTION PROBLEM THAT IS TO MINIMIZE THE MAXIMUM FLOW THROUGH A CAPACITATED NETWORK FROM THE SOURCE TO THE SINK WHERE THE ARC CAPACITIES ARE UNCERTAIN VARIABLES. IT IS ASSUMED THAT IN THE ABSENCE OF HISTORICAL DATA, ONLY THE EXPERTS’ OPINION BASED ON HIS EXPERIENCES IS AVAILABLE TO ESTIMATE ARC CAPACITIES.

THIS PAPER PRESENTS A NEW FORMULATION FOR STOCHASTIC NETWORK INTERDICTION WITH ENDOGENOUS UNCERTAINTY, IN WHICH OPTIMIZATION DECISIONS CAN INFLUENCE STOCHASTIC PROCESSES BY ALTERING THE CORRESPONDING PROBABILITY SPACE. AS AN APPLICATION, WE CAN CONSIDER A PLANNING PROBLEM IN WHICH A DECISION MAKER (INTERDICTOR), SUBJECT TO LIMITED RESOURCES, INSTALLS SOME DETECTORS AT BORDER CHECKPOINTS IN A TRANSPORTATION NETWORK IN ORDER TO MINIMIZE THE PROBABILITY THAT A SMUGGLER CAN TRAVERSE THE RESIDUAL NETWORK UNDETECTED OR TO MAXIMIZE THE SMUGGLERS TRAVERSING COST. THE DETECTING PROBABILITIES ARE ASSUMED TO BE KNOWN A PRIORI, AND INSTALLING DETECTOR DECREASES THE LIKELIHOOD OF DETECTION.THE RESULTING PROBLEM IS A TWO STAGE STOCHASTIC PROGRAM, IN THAT, AT THE FIRST STAGE THE INTERDICTOR DECIDES WHICH LINKS TO INSTALL DETECTOR FOR INTERDICTING THE SMUGGLER’S MOVES BY DETECTING HIM OR DECREASING HIS TRAVERSING COST. THE INTERDICTOR’S DECISION CAN INFLUENCE THE PROBABILITIES OF TRAVERSING LINKS SUCCESSFULLY. IN THE SECOND STAGE THE SMUGGLER SEEKS TO CHOOSE THE SHORTEST S-T PATH IN THE SURVIVAL NETWORK. THE RESULTING TWO STAGE PROGRAMMING PROBLEM IS NON-LINEAR DUE TO EXISTING OF SCENARIO PROBABILITIES PRODUCTS. WE USE DISTRIBUTION SHAPING APPROACH TO HANDLE DECISION-DEPENDENT PROBABILITIES. IT USES A SEQUENCE OF DISTRIBUTIONS, SUCCESSIVELY CONDITIONED ON THE INFLUENCING DECISION VARIABLES, AND CHARACTERIZES THESE BY LINEAR INEQUALITIES.

One of the key issues raised in NETWORKs ow is its INTERDICTION. Keshavarzi et al. scrutinized the issue with the multi-sources and multi-sinks conditions in mind while considering the speci c conditions of ow being sent from sources to sinks [R. Keshavarzi et al., Multi-source-sinks NETWORK ow INTERDICTION problem, International Journal of Academic Research, 2015]. Moreover, the matter was also examined in the state of multi-interdictors and a practical solution was presented [Keshavarzi and, Salehi, Multi commodity multi source-sinks NETWORK ow INTERDICTION problem with several interdictors, Journal of Engineering and Applied Sciences, 2015]. In this paper, the NETWORKs ow INTERDICTION in multi-source and multi-sink conditions was addressed; meanwhile, bearing in mind the uncertain data (from a speci ed beginning to an ending interval), an optimal interval was presented. Finally, a numerical example for this issue was provided and then solved by the program "Lingo".

In this paper, we state the problem of the NETWORK flow INTERDICTION in a set of initial and destination nodes so that each initial is capable of only delivering products to certain pre-determined destinations. The NETWORK user’s purpose is to deliver the highest value of flow from the sources to the sinks and the NETWORK interdictor’s purpose is to reduce the highest value of flow being used. In this paper, the NETWORKs flow INTERDICTION in multi-source and multi-sink conditions are addressed in a way that the parameters of arc capacity are trapezoidal fuzzy sets.

We described the two-stage maximum flow NETWORK INTERDICTION problem under endogenous stochastic INTERDICTION. Our model consists of two adversary agent playing a Stackelberg game. A smuggler who wishes to maximize the expected flow of some illicit commodities (same as drugs), can be transmitted between a source node and a sink node without being detected. On the other hand, an attacker tries to minimize the objective of the smugglers by installing some detectors or adding some security controls on critical arcs to increase the probability of detection. Most previous stochastic NETWORK INTERDICTION problems in the literature deal with exogenous uncertainty, while we consider stochastic programs under endogenous uncertainty in which the interdictor’ s decisions can alter the probability measures. The problem can be formulated as a bi-level program, at the top level the attacker by a limited budget, choosing critical arcs to install detectors and enhance the INTERDICTION probability of those arcs endogenously. The bottom level problem is a two-stage problem which is solved to find the maximum flow in the NETWORK by smugglers. In the first stage, he chooses some links to transmit the flow. In the second stage an indicator variable is used to show if he would be detected under each scenario. The bi-level decomposition algorithm has been applied to solve the problem by adding some Benders’ cuts iteratively. We applied a successive method, to deal with non-linearity rise in the probability measure of each path. A case study of drug trafficking NETWORK is applied to recognize which countries have the most significant effect in interdicting the drug trafficking NETWORK. The police can concentrate on those areas to decline the amount of drug flow. Our results demonstrate that if the critical arcs are chosen wisely and the probability of drug seizers decreases slightly, a significant decrease in the expected total flow of drugs can be achieved.

We consider the maximum flow NETWORK INTERDICTION problem. We provide a new interpretation of the problem and define a concept called ”optimalcut”. We propose a heuristic algorithm to obtain an approximated cut, and we also obtain its error bound. Finally, we show that our heuristic is an α-approximation algorithm for a class of NETWORKs. By implementing it on three NETWORK types, we show the advantage of it over solving the model by CPLEX.

The importance of locating critical facilities in hierarchical service delivery systems and fortification them against intentional attacks is the main subject of many researches, which helps the stability of the service system during intentional attacks by making appropriate decisions on location and fortification.‎ In this paper , for the first time , the problem of locating hierarchical facilities with regard to the fortification and INTERDICTION operations in a tri-level programming model between system designer , defender and attacker has been proposed.‎‎ The aim of the system designer at the first level is to minimize the location cost and service distance between the demand points and two categories of facilities.‎ The defender's objective is to adopt appropriate fortification operations at the second level in order to minimize the distance between customers and the nearest facility to receive primary services and referrals for secondary services according to available location resources.‎ Meanwhile, the attacker in the third level of the model, as a follower, seeks to make decisions to assign customers to two categories of facilities and INTERDICTION operations in order to maximize the service system distances.‎ To solve the new problem, a hybrid metaheuristic method based on genetic algorithm, simulated annealing algorithm and CPLEX has been proposed, and by solving several numerical examples, the the analysis of the results and the relation between the model parameters and the goals of the hierarchical service system is investigated.

The purpose of the matching INTERDICTION problem in the weighted graph G is to find a subset of vertices R*Í V such that the weight of the maximum matching in the graph G [V\R*] is minimized. According to the maximum matching in G, an approximate solution, denoted by R, for this problem is presented. Suppose that v (G) is the weight of the maximum matching in G. In this paper, we consider dendrimers as graphs such that the weights of edges are the bond lengths. We obtain the maximum matching in some types of dendrimers. Then, we compute the value of (v (G)-v (G [V\R*])) (v (G) - v (G [V\R])) for them. It is shown that this ratio in these classes of dendrimers is equal to the maximum value.

In the maximum flow NETWORK INTERDICTION problem, an attacker attempts to minimize the maximum flow by interdicting flow on the arcs of NETWORK. In this paper, our focus is on the nodal INTERDICTION for NETWORK instead of the arc INTERDICTION. Two path inequalities for the node-only INTERDICTION problem are represented. It has been proved that the integrality gap of relaxation of the maximum flow NETWORK INTERDICTION problem is not bounded below by a constant, even when strengthened by the path inequalities. We show that this result is also established for the nodal INTERDICTION problem.
